Casa Matriz del Banco República, Neoclassical bank headquarters in Ciudad Vieja, Montevideo, Uruguay.

The main building of Banco República exhibits grand columns, symmetrical shapes, and decorative sculptures across its imposing stone facade at Ciudad Vieja district.

Italian architect Giovanni Veltroni designed this financial institution in 1934, marking a period when Uruguay was establishing its banking infrastructure.

The exterior sculptures, created by José Luis Zorrilla de San Martín in the 1940s, include a representation of national hero José Gervasio Artigas.

The bank headquarters stands near multiple public transportation routes and remains an active financial center in Montevideo's historic district.

The building appeared in the 2014 short film Protocolo Celeste, featuring actress Natalia Oreiro and footballer Diego Forlán as agents recovering a stolen medal.
